2) Set Time
a) Turn on the unit and then press the “SETUP” button
b) The menu icon will start to blink, press the “UP” or “DOWN” button until icon 2 “TIME”
is blinking, press “OK” to enter.
c) Then the LCD first two digits represent hour (HH) and last two digits represents minutes
(MM).
d) Press “UP” or “DOWN” to select hour between 00-23, Press “OK” to confirm. Then it
comes to minutes setting.
e) Press “UP” or “DOWN” to select minute between 00-59, Press “OK” to confirm.
f) If the setting is done, press “SETUP” to save and exit the setting.
▲ Don’t forget to reset the Date & Time stamp after you replace the batteries.
6.4 Display How Many Pictures and Video Taken
a) Turn on the unit and then press the “SETUP” button
b) The menu icon will start to blink, press the “UP” or “DOWN” button until icon 8 “SD Card” is
blinking.
c) Then the LCD will display the total number of the picture and video taken in this SD card.
7. Using the Camera
7.1 Mounting the Camera
It is recommended that you mount the camera 1.2~1.5 meters off the ground with the camera
pointed at a slight downward angle. Be sure to avoid mounting the camera facing east or west as
the rising and setting of the sun could produce false triggers and overexposed images. Make sure
the camera is clear of any tree branches or debris so that the camera lens and/or PIR sensor are
not obstructed.
